Disputing a Toll in Massachusetts

Massachusetts uses all-electronic tolling on the Mass Pike and metro Boston tunnels and bridges through EZDriveMA, billing non-transponder drivers via Pay By Plate.

Step-by-Step Filing Instructions

  1. Act before your deadline — 30 days from the pay by plate invoice date. Note the exact response date printed on your notice.
  2. Gather your evidence — vehicle registration, transponder statement, bill of sale, or police report.
  3. Write a dispute letter stating your plate number, notice number, violation date, and the reason you're disputing.
  4. Submit through the agency's official portal, or send by certified mail so you have proof of the submission date.
  5. Keep copies of everything and follow up if you don't receive a response within about 30 days.

What to Expect After You File

Once your dispute is submitted, the toll authority reviews your evidence and the original toll image before responding — most decisions in Massachusetts arrive within 30 to 90 days. Sending your letter by certified mail, or keeping the confirmation number from an online submission, gives you proof that you filed on time if you ever need to escalate.

If your dispute is approved, the charge is dismissed or reduced and any related late fees are typically removed. If it's denied, you usually still have the right to request a hearing or pay the reduced base toll. Either way, responding in writing before the deadline protects you from registration holds and collection activity, which are far harder to undo later.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I add my plate to an E-ZPass account after a Pay By Plate bill in MA?

Yes, and if the trip was covered by a valid transponder account you can ask EZDriveMA to rebill at the lower E-ZPass rate.

How long do Massachusetts toll disputes take?

Most reviews are completed within a few weeks of submitting documentation.
